What is feminicide in Guatemala?

Femicide in Guatemala is a serious and persistent problem. It refers to the murders of women and girls due to their gender. Guatemala has one of the highest rates of feminicide in the world. Although the country has enacted laws to try to address this problem, such as the Law against Femicide and other Forms of Violence against Women, the implementation of these laws remains a challenge.

Can a Peruvian citizen obtain a DNI if he or she resides abroad but wishes to vote in Peruvian elections?

Yes, a Peruvian citizen who resides abroad and wishes to vote in Peruvian elections can obtain or renew their DNI through the Peruvian embassies and consulates in the country of residence. The DNI is necessary to participate in electoral processes and exercise the right to vote from abroad.

What is the regime of final participation in assets in a Brazilian marriage?

The regime of final participation in the assets in a Brazilian marriage is a property regime in which each spouse maintains the ownership and administration of their assets individually during the marriage. Upon dissolution of the marriage, the assets acquired by each spouse during the union are added, and the spouse who acquired fewer assets is entitled to receive financial compensation from the other spouse to balance the property division.
